Pulitzer Prize winner Maureen Dowd turns her sharp eye on America's celebrity elite in this collection of her most memorable profiles. The New York Times columnist deploys wit as her primary weapon, cutting through the carefully constructed personas of cultural powerhouses. Her subjects span entertainment dynasties and corporate boardrooms alike. Hollywood luminaries including Uma Thurman, Jane Fonda, and Greta Gerwig face her penetrating questions. Leading men Paul Newman, Idris Elba, and Ralph Fiennes reveal themselves under her scrutiny. Comedy legends Tina Fey, Mel Brooks, and Larry David submit to her probing interviews. Fashion icons Andre Leon Talley, Ann Roth, and Tom Ford open their worlds to her investigation. Tech and media moguls Elon Musk, Bob Iger, and Peter Thiel endure her incisive commentary. Dowd's signature approach combines insider access with outsider perspective, creating portraits that capture both glamour and vulnerability. This compilation offers readers an escape from political turbulence through intimate glimpses of fame's inner workings.
